Mes Amis is a new generation French-inspired brasserie that evokes the vibrant spirit of bustling eateries along the Grands Boulevards of Paris. Using the freshest ingredients from both local farms and specialty markets from around the world, this effortlessly chic culinary destination is a celebration of great food and great friends.

We had a great experience at this restaurant for a friends Birthday. I had the New York strip the way the Chef recommended and it was one of the best New York strips I have had in Los Angeles. The only reason I am not giving this place a 5 star is because they were out of a few items which we were informed about after we ordered. In terms of service it was great. Server was attentive and they did offer a dessert on the house for the inventory issues. Be advised, they are cashless so you will need to provide a credit card.

First impression was excellent: a vibrant place with Brigitte Bardot posters and modernized Old Hollywood vibe. Although some small details were off – dead roses in the hostess’s vase, all waiters saying “Bridget” instead of Brigitte (if you have several pictures of her hanging around and a cocktail named after her, teach your staff how to pronounce her name), some confusion to sit us down – we were anxious to try the food. It missed the rendezvous. The pâté was bland despite an interesting side of pickled peaches, the entrees we had – including their steak, which they served to our incredulity with, basically, bread – were unremarkable for their price, and their baba au rhum was actually outrageous, tasting like toothpaste. There is potential but the food needs to be improved.
